Founded in 2009, Spring Venture Group is a holding company made up of two direct-to-consumer health insurance brands, United Medicare Advisors and SmartMatch Insurance Agency, LLC. Powered by analytics, technology and human connection, we have changed the way that the 65+ market shops for insurance through an internally developed comparison shopping technology. Our personalized process eases the burden for our clients and delivers a friendlier and more simple experience. Job Description

The Customer Success Agent (CSA) is responsible for making outbound and receiving inbound calls to Medicare Supplement/Advantage clients. The primary focus of the position is to retain our book of business. Hence, the role requires the ability to build rapport, educate our clientele, answer questions clearly, and focus on issue resolution. The CSA also must be able to seek and deliver on new business opportunities as well as work with our existing clients to make changes to their coverage or add additional coverage to their current portfolio. This position is fast-paced, requires effective time management, and must focus on delivering an exceptional customer experience. 

  • Starting pay is $22/hr + uncapped commission earnings on an increasing pay structure. Target compensation is $61,534. 

  • Immersive, hands-on training

  • Hours are full-time Monday - Friday between 8 am - 5 pm CST with some opportunity for OT during busier seasons. 

  • Paid nationwide insurance licensing.

The essential duties for this role include, but are not limited to:  

  • Make outbound calls to an assigned portion of the agency book of business in order to offer assistance or to rewrite the policy.  

  • Ensure the fulfillment of any rewritten business.  

  • Provide answers to customer questions that cover a range of topics in the Medicare  Supplement/Advantage spectrum.  

  • Investigate and resolve any payment complications for policyholders. 

  • Simultaneously navigate multiple systems while conducting consumer calls. 

  • Complete case management tasks (i.e., create, document, close, etc.) in Salesforce. 

  • Cross-sell ancillary products to existing clients. 

  • Identify and engage in new business and selling opportunities as they become available. 

  • Meet department goals and key performance indicators, including monthly occupancy rates.  

  • Attend and contribute to regularly scheduled and ad hoc team meetings and training sessions.  

  • Deliver a consistent and exceptional customer experience by maintaining a positive,  empathetic, and professional attitude toward customers at all times.  

  • Per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

Work from home requirements: 

  • Existing reliable hard-wired, high-speed internet connection with an Ethernet port

    • Required internet speed: 30+ mbps download, 10+ mbps upload speeds 

    • Recommended: 100+ mbps download, 25+ mbps upload speeds 

  • Cell phone system updated within the last two years for system access 

  • Designated workplace that is HIPAA compliant 

    • Private, quiet work area that can accommodate a desktop computer with multiple monitors (computer equipment will be provided) 

    • Ability to focus 100% on SVG responsibilities during designated work hours
